 /**
- * Generic toolbar tool.
+ * Tools, together with {@link OO.ui.ToolGroup toolgroups}, constitute {@link 
OO.ui.Toolbar toolbars}.
+ * Each tool is configured with a static name, title, and icon and is 
customized with the command to carry
+ * out when the tool is selected. Tools must also be registered with a {@link 
OO.ui.ToolFactory tool factory},
+ * which creates the tools on demand.
+ *
+ * Tools are added to toolgroups ({@link OO.ui.ListToolGroup ListToolGroup},
+ * {@link OO.ui.BarToolGroup BarToolGroup}, or {@link OO.ui.MenuToolGroup 
MenuToolGroup}), which determine how
+ * the tool is displayed in the toolbar. See {@link OO.ui.Toolbar toolbars} 
for an example.
+ *
+ * For more information, please see the [OOjs UI documentation on 
MediaWiki][1].
+ * [1]: https://www.mediawiki.org/wiki/OOjs_UI/Toolbars
  *
  * @abstract
  * @class
@@ -11,7 +21,16 @@
  * @constructor
  * @param {OO.ui.ToolGroup} toolGroup
  * @param {Object} [config] Configuration options
- * @cfg {string|Function} [title] Title text or a function that returns text
+ * @cfg {string|Function} [title] Title text or a function that returns text. 
If this config is omitted, the value of
+ *  the {@link #static-title static title} property is used.
+ *
+ *  The title is used in different ways depending on the type of toolgroup 
that contains the tool. The
+ *  title is used as a tooltip if the tool is part of a {@link 
OO.ui.BarToolGroup bar} toolgroup, or as the label text if the tool is
+ *  part of a {@link OO.ui.ListToolGroup list} or {@link OO.ui.MenuToolGroup 
menu} toolgroup.
+ *
+ *  For bar toolgroups, a description of the accelerator key is appended to 
the title if an accelerator key
+ *  is associated with an action by the same name as the tool and accelerator 
functionality has been added to the application.
+ *  To add accelerator key functionality, you must subclass OO.ui.Toolbar and 
override the {@link OO.ui.Toolbar#getToolAccelerator getToolAccelerator} method.
  */
